Monday, January 10, 2011

Valentine

This is the second project we made at technique night this month.  It uses the new impressions folder in the Occasions Mini.  I've used a scrap of CS to create the back of the Top Note, layed a sheet of adhesive over it, layered on the DSP, and then cut it out using the Big Shot.  Makes this project very easy :)  Order your supplies here.
Cardstock:  Real Red, Pretty in Pink, Newspaper DSP, Brights Patterns DSP, Subtles Patterns DSP
Ink:  Real Red
Stamps:  Filled with Love
Accessories:  Big Shot, Top Note Die, Framed Tulips Impressions Embossing Folder, Chantilly Crochet Trim, Pretty in Pink Grosgrain Ribbon, Dimensionals, 3/4" & 1" Circle Punches

Sunday, January 9, 2011

Love

When I started stamping again, I knew I wanted to start working on Valentine's Day cards but realized I haven't ordered any Valentine DSP yet.  I happened to look in the Play Date DSP package and found this CUTE heart paper!  Perfect!!!!  This greeting is first stamped in Pretty in Pink ink and then stamped in the Real Red ink.  I smoothed the line in between the two inks with a sponge.  I love the effect of the two-toned stamping :)  Order your supplies here.
Cardstock:  Real Red, Pretty in Pink, Whisper White, Play Date DSP
Ink:  Pretty in Pink, Real Red
Stamps:  Filled With Love
Accessories:  Real Red Satin Ribbon, Brights Buttons, 2-way glue

Friday, April 30, 2010

Cheerful Thank You

One of my favorite stamp sets from the Occasions Mini has been "With all my Heart." I've found so many different uses for this stamp set :) This idea came from the IB&C. It's a card sketch that was used with the "Tart and Tangy" stamp set. I realized I could use many different stamp sets for this same effect but decided to use "With all my Heart" one more time before you can't order it anymore, and the stamp becomes part of my personal stamp collection. The key to this card is to stamp twice and then punch each one out with a different circle punch....I used a 1" and a 3/4" circles. Order your supplies here.
Cardstock: Only Orange, Green Galore, Yoyo Yellow (yes, all leaving the end of June), Whisper White
Ink: Only Orange, Green Galore, Yoyo Yellow
Stamps: With All My Heart
Accessories: 1" & 3/4" circle punches, dimensionals, Yoyo Yellow Grosgrain Ribbon ( retired)
